The law of cosines is used to find the measure of Angle Z. Triangle X Y Z is shown. The length of X Y is 16, the length of Y Z i

s 19, and the length of X Z is 18. To the nearest whole degree, what is the measure of Angle Z? 41º 47º 51º 57º

Answer:

The correct option is third one  51°.

Therefore,

m\angle Z=51\°

Step-by-step explanation:

Given:

In Triangle XYZ

XY = z = 16

YZ = x = 19

ZX = y = 18  

To Find

angle Z = ?

Solution:

In Triangle XYZ, Cosine Rule says

\cos Z=\dfrac{x^{2}+y^{2}-z^{2}}{2xy}

Substituting the values we get

\cos Z=\dfrac{19^{2}+18^{2}-16^{2}}{2\times 19\times 18}

\cos Z=\dfrac{429}{684}=0.6271

m\angle Z=\cos^{-1}(0.6271)=51\°

Therefore,

m\angle Z=51\°

The midpoint of segment AB is (4, 2). The coordinates of point A are (2, 7). Find the coordinates of point B.

Answer:

<h3>The option B) is correct</h3><h3>Therefore the coordinate of B(x_2,y_2) is (6,-3)</h3>

Step-by-step explanation:

Given that the midpoint of segment AB is (4, 2). The coordinates of point A is (2, 7).

<h3>To Find the coordinates of point B:</h3>
  • Let the coordinate of A be (x_1,y_1) is (2,7) respectively
  • Let the coordinate of B be (x_2,y_2)
  • And Let M(x,y) be the mid point of line segment AB is (4,2) respectively
  • The mid-point formula is
<h3>M(x,y)=(\frac{x_1+x_2}{2},\frac{y_1+y_2}{2})</h3>
  • Now substitute the coordinates int he above formula we get
  • (4,2)=(\frac{2+x_2}{2},\frac{7+y_2}{2})
  • Now equating we get

4=\frac{2+x_2}{2}                    2=\frac{7+y_2}{2}

Multiply by 2 we get                             Multiply by 2 we get  

4(2)=2+x_2                                           2(2)=7+y_2

8=2+x_2                                                4=7+y_2

Subtracting 2 on both

the sides                                    Subtracting 7 on both the sides

8-2=2+x_2-2                                4-7=7+y_2-7

6=x_2                                                       -3=y_2

Rewritting the above equation      Rewritting the equation

x_2=6                                                      y_2=-3

<h3>Therefore the coordinate of B(x_2,y_2) is (6,-3)</h3><h3>Therefore the option B) is correct.</h3>
